Abstract

Guiding barrier fishing gear has been used in recent years in the mangrove, seagrass, and coral ecosystem areas of Bontang City. In previous studies, the main target, white-spotted spinefoot fish, has depreciated and degraded as a result of overfishing. This study calculates the economic benefits and attempts to analyze the management policy of guiding barrier fishing gear to overcome the depreciation and degradation problems. To calculate the economic benefits, the fisheries production approach was used, while the policy analysis used the interpretive structural model technique. During the peak season of white-spotted spinefoot fish, the average fisherman earns up to IDR400,750 per day, with a minimum of IDR103,000 and a maximum of IDR1,904,000. The optimal fishing period is nine months, after which fishermen will stop fishing in Ramadan, August, and September. There are six guiding barrier fishing gear management policies, namely: 1) open and close systems at the installation site; 2) increase the mesh size used; 3) reduce the number; 4) moratorium on new installations; 5) limit the number of owners for each fisherman; and 6) regulate the distance between guiding barrier fishing gear. Of the six policy alternatives, the top priority is to increase the mesh size used.

Abstract

The availability of fish feed has remained an obstacle in the fish cultivation until now. The dependence on fish flour, soy flour, the imported cornstarch has not been solved, though the natural resource in Indonesia supports the dependence of this raw material availability. This research was conducted by testing the use of the fermented cassava flour to substitute cornstarch as the catfish feed, by adding natural drug product, BIOIMUNÒ, which positively affected growth, immunity, and production. Research methodology used was the Completely Randomized Design with six treatments and three repetitions. Fishes with average weight of 10 g and length of 10 cm were raised in the aquarium with dimension of 60x40x40 cm, with the density of 10 fishes per aquarium. The research was conducted for 60 days with observation every 14 days. Compositions of cornstarch and cassava flour were P1 (0/200), P2 (100/100), P3 (75/125), P4 (50/150), P5 (25/175), and P6 (commercial feed), added with BIOIMUNÒ at 20 ml/kg from the extracts of Solanum ferox and Zingiber zerumbet. Feed was given three times at a percentage of 5%. This research showed the result that the best growth was in treatment (P3), with 75 g of cornstarch and 125 g of cassava flour (75/125). The highest absolute weight gain was in P3 at 132.67 ± 8.33 g. The immunity system testing was in accordance with the result of phytochemical test of positive alkaloid, negative flavonoid, and negative steroid. Survival Rate (SR) based on the variance analysis (ANOVA) had an insignificant effect (P>0.05) 93.00-100.00%. P3 feed conversion rate was 5.35±0.23. Hematocrit level and total erythrocyte with a decent score and total leukocyte increased from P6. Feed proximate test was in accordance with the standard. Total bacteria were in the normal range, the contamination test on heavy metal proved no harm against the catfishes, and the water quality was normal. In terms of economic analysis, P1-P5 were more affordable than (P6), so that it can be concluded that the fermented cassava flour can be used as a replacement of corn by adding BIOIMUNÒ as the catfish feed.

Abstract

Research analysis of the Eucheuma cottoni seaweed cultivation business was conducted in July-September 2022 located in Bontang Kuala Village, Bontang City. The purpose of this study was to analyze the E.cottoni seaweed cultivation business financially by calculating production costs, revenue, and profits from the E.cottoni seaweed cultivation business, and analyzing the feasibility of E.cottoni seaweed cultivation business in Bontang Kuala Village, Bontang City. The selection of the location of this research was carried out intentionally with the consideration that there were E.cottoni seaweed cultivation business actors in Bontang Kuala Village, Bontang City, and the determination of respondents was carried out by census. Date using analysis with the formula Total cost (TC), Revenue or gross income (TR), profit analysis (π), Financial analysis Net Present Value (NPV), Net Benefit Cost Ratio (Net B/C), Internal Rate of Return (IRR), and Payback period. The results showed that the investment value incurred by E.cottoni seaweed cultivators was 77,726,000 with the largest investment cost being the drying floor of IDR 30,000,000 and the smallest investment cost being a knife of IDR 24,000. The revenue obtained by E.cottoni seaweed cultivators was 345,600,000/year with the selling price of dried seaweed at the time of this research carried out at IDR 8,000/kg of the amount of dried seaweed production of 34,560 kg/year. NPV obtained from the calculation of 429,564,890. Net B/C generated in the seaweed cultivation business in Bontang Kuala Village is 6.53. The IRR value obtained is 137%. The payback period (PP) value obtained based on calculations is 1.5 years or 18 months. Based on the calculation obtained NPV>0, Net B / C>1, IRR>OCC (3%) seaweed cultivation in its business in Bontang Kuala Village the development of its business is feasible and can be continued because it can still cover the operational costs incurred and make a profit.

Abstract

This study aimed to determine the practicality of interactive multimedia based on a scientific approach to the learning process of Pascal's Law for high school students. This study used a questionnaire instrument consisting of five items, namely (1) media attractiveness and accessibility, (2) media structure and understanding, (3) training and concept mastery, (4) additional aspects, and (5) the impact of using multimedia. The subjects of this study involved physics teachers and 11th-grade MIPA students at Ar Rohmah IIBS Malang High School. The sampling technique in this study was convenience sampling. The data obtained were analyzed using quantitative methods with descriptive analysis techniques. Based on the study results, the percentage of multimedia practicality assessed by teachers reached 85%, while those assessed by students reached 96%. Based on these percentage values, this interactive multimedia based on a scientific approach to the learning process of Pascal's Law for high school students is classified as practical and can be further tested for effectiveness.

Abstract

The current concept of aquaculture technology development prioritizes zero waste discharge fish/shrimp production systems through an in situ biofiltration process to maintain water quality and recycle aquaculture waste into a highly nutritious supplementary feed source. This study aims to 1) Analyze the abundance, diversity, and dominance of plakton in tilapia rearing tanks of biofloc system with the addition of molasses and sugarcane juice as carbohydrate sources, 2) Analyzing the growth rate of tilapia specifications, weight growth, and length of tilapia (O.niloticus) in biofloc systems treated with the addition of molasses and sugarcane juice as a carbohydrate source. This study used the t-student test with a confidence level of 95%, with 2 treatments namely; P1 giving molasses; P2 giving sugarcane juice. The results showed that the addition of different carbohydrate sources in tilapia enlargement resulted in the highest tilapia weight growth in the P1 treatment with the addition of molasses has an average value of 32.97 g. P2 treatment with the addition of sugar cane juice has an average value of 24.55 g. In length growth has the highest average value in the P1 treatment given the addition of molasses which is 2.37 cm while for P2 with sugar cane juice treatment has a value of 2.27cm. The specific growth rate of tilapia was highest in the P2 treatment with an average value of 1.79% / day, while the P1 treatment had an average value of 1.51% / day. From the results of statistical analysis on weight growth and specific growth of tilapia significantly different but not significantly different from the growth of tilapia length. Plankton abundance in this study showed differences in each treatment, the results of observations from research for 30 days found data that the treatment of molasses has a plankton abundance value of 3780 individual plankton / l while for the treatment of sugar cane juice has a value of 2772 individual plankton / l. The conclusion of this study is the abundance of plankton in the fish tank. The conclusion of this study is that the abundance of plankton in the molasses pond treatment shows more diverse results and a higher abundance index compared to the sugar cane juice treatment, so the molasses-treated pond shows more fertile waters than the sugar cane juice treatment. Then for the growth of length and weight of tilapia given additional molasses showed better results than sugar cane juice, due to the addition of molasses can accelerate the growth of tilapia

Abstract

Penilaian kinerja guru dilaksanakan untuk mewujudkan guru yang profesional, karena harkat dan martabat suatu profesi ditentukan oleh kualitas layanan profesi yang bermutu. Penelitian ini bertujuan untuk mendeskripsikan perencanaan, pelaksanaan (actualiting), pengawasan (controlling) dan evaluasi manajemen penilaian kinerja guru oleh kepala sekolah dalam peningkatkan mutu pembelajaran di SD Negeri Kecamatan Kaubun Kabupaten Kutai Timur. Penelitian ini menggunakan pendekatan kualitatif deskriptif. Teknik pengumpulan data melalui observasi, wawancara dan dokumentasi. Hasil penelitian menunjukkan (1) Perencanaan penilaian kinerja guru yaitu, persiapan membentuk Tim penilaian kinerja guru, sosialisasi penilaian kinerja guru melalui rapat dewan guru, pembagian SK Tim, menyiapkan pedoman pelaksanaan penilaian kinerja guru, menyiapkan instrumen penilaian kinerja guru, menyiapkan instrumen kinerja guru, pengumpulan data dan fakta, penilaian, dan laporan penilaian kinerja guru; (2) Pelaksanaan penilaian kinerja guru dilaksanakan melalui pengamatan dan pemantauan (actualiting). Pengamatan adalah kegiatan untuk menilai kinerja guru sebelum, selama, dan setelah pelaksanaan proses pembelajaran. Pemantauan adalah kegiatan untuk menilai kinerja guru melalui pemeriksaan dokumen atau administrasi pembelajaran, observasi pelaksanaan pembelajaran wawancara peserta didik dan orang tua; (3) pengawasan (controlling) oleh kepala sekolah yaitu melakukan pengawasan terhadap kedisplinan waktu, Mengawasi guru yang sering absen sekolah; mengecek perangkat pembelajaran, melihat cara guru membangun komunikasi dalam lingkungan sekolah, baik itu sesama guru maupun dengan siswa, penggunaan sarana dan prasarana sekolah; (4) Evaluasi proses dalam penelitian ini meliputi observasi dan dokumentasi terhadap kemampuan guru dalam merancang pembelajaran, dan melaksanakan pembelajaran. Kesimpulan: penilaian kinerja guru sebagai upaya dalam peningkatan kinerja guru dan mutu pembelajaran di kelas.

Abstract

In the tenth-grade students of SMA Negeri 4 Pontianak, this study aims to measure the effectiveness of the Discovery Learning model using a Flipbook in enhancing the understanding of the Plantae material. The study adopts a quasi-experimental design with a non-equivalent control group design. Two entire classes were selected as the research sample: Class X MIA 2 as the experimental group receiving the treatment and Class X MIA 4 as the control group without treatment for comparison. The research instrument consisted of a multiple-choice test with a total of 20 items. The comparison of the average scores between the experimental group (15.89) and the control group (15.17) indicates a significant improvement in the experimental group. However, statistical analysis using the Mann-Whitney U test shows no statistically significant difference between the two learning groups. The 13.68% improvement in students' learning outcomes on the Plantae material can be attributed to the implementation of the learning model used in this study.

Abstract

Studi ini dilakukan berdasarkan Peraturan Menteri Negara Lingkungan Hidup Nomor 29 Tahun 2009 Tentang Pedoman Konservasi Keanekaragaman Hayati di daerah yaitu dilakukan secara eksplorasi dengan kombinasi metode Focus Group Discussion (FGD) untuk mengumpulkan data keanekaraman hayati.Hasil studi menunjukan bahwa keanekaragaman hayati Kabupaten Kotawaringin Barat cukup tinggi, dimana jenis liar daratan dan perairan yang belum bernilai ekonomi teridentifikasi untuk jenis tumbuhan sebanyak 532 jenis dan satwa sebanyak 879 Jenis. Jenis liar daratan dan perairan yang sudah bernilai ekonomi dari jenis tumbuhan teridentifikasi 15 jenis dan satwa sebanyak 39 Jenis. Jenis yang sudah dibudidayakan teridentifikasi sebanyak 134 jenis. Jenis tumbuhan obat berdasarkan pengetahuan tradisional ditemukan sebanyak 90 jenisKeanekaragaman hayati di Kabupaten Kotawaringin Barat menjadi aset dalam pembangunan daerah. Dilain sisi, bertambahnya jumlah penduduk akan berbanding lurus terhadap aktifitas pemanfaatan sumberdaya hayati. Hal ini dapat menjadi ancaman terhadap keanekaragaman hayati jika pemanfaatannya dilakukan secara tidak bijaksana. Terganggunya keanekaragaman hayati akan berpotensi menimbulkan ketidakseimbangan lingkungan yang berdampak pada munculnya penyakit dan bencana alam. Karena itu, penting menjaga kestabilannya dengan cara melakukan pematauan secara berkelanjutan melalui pembaharuan data tahunan
